Here are two brand new gameplay videos for Resident Evil: The Darkside Chronicles! This game is a follow up to Resident Evil: The Umbrella Chronicles, and is also an “on rails”, arcade style shooter. You don’t control the characters movement, you just shoot, reload, pickup items, and use your knife. Perfect for the Wii and the Wiimote. Darkside Chronicles takes you through the stories of Resident Evil 2, probably the best Resident Evil game ever, and Resident Evil: Code Veronica. Check out another video below!

This is the latest trailer for Capcom’s Resident Evil: The Darkside Chronicles, from E3 2009. This game is the followup to Resident Evil: The Umbrella Chronicles, and takes us through the story of Resident Evil 2 and Resident Evil: Code Veronica.
The graphics are updated and the game is “on rails”, but watching this trailer just gives me a nostalgia attack. Growing up during the “Playstation era”, Resident Evil, especially Resident Evil 2, is one of my favorite games of all time. Sure, it’s not a remake, like many fans want, but it’s enough…for now.
The Darkside Chronicles hits the Nintendo Wii sometime towards the end of the year!
